This time we are sponsored by Whoopsie Daisy and The Stamping Boutique.  My first card is using one of the images from Whoopsie Daisy Sheet 185, you get four images on each sheet and they are all gorgeous.


I decided to make a thank you card, we will be needing quite a few of those in our house.  I coloured her with ProMarkers and added glitter to her wings and the flower in her hair.  The papers are Papermania layered onto Core'dinations card stock.  Full details of everything I have used are listed below.

The inside of my card has been decorated to complement the front.

Card Recipe

Image:  Whoopsie Daisy - Sheet 185
Papers:  Papermania Capsule Collection - Boysenberry
Tools:  Spellbinders - Classic Squares, Martha Stewart Punch, Cuttlebug Embossing Folder
Embellishments:  buttons, twine, ribbon, glitter and gem from stash
Sentiment:  LOTV
